Chris Williamson calls for Labour supporters to #backthecode in Twitterstorm
Left groups including Jewish Voice for Labour backing mass declaration of support for the party NEC on anti-semitism
Derby North MP Chris Williamson said Corbyn's critics will not be appeased by concessions

A SENIOR backbench MP has called for activists to take part in a Twitterstorm tomorrow evening backing Labour’s anti-semitism code.

The campaign supports Labour’s national executive committee (NEC’s) adoption of the International Holocaust Remembrance Alliance (IHRA) definition, but with guidance to accompany the IHRA’s examples of anti-semitism, which Labour says is intended to prevent political criticism of Israel being conflated with anti-Jewish prejudice.

The Twitterstorm – backed by groups including Jewish Voice for Labour and the Jewish Socialist Group – calls on supporters of the NEC position to support the #backthecode campaign on Twitter and Facebook from 7pm tomorrow.
